This subcontract for the Erie Metropolitan Housing Authority involves the supply of new hydraulic elevator oil and the legal removal and disposal of old oil for prime contractors. The selected provider is responsible for extracting and hauling old oil from existing systems and ensuring all hazardous waste disposal is performed in strict accordance with environmental regulations. The contractor must possess all necessary hazardous waste hauling and disposal certifications and provide comprehensive documentation for the disposal process. This opportunity is based in Sandusky, Ohio, with a response deadline of November 9, 2026.

ARS Tifton Hazardous Waste Removal
Solicitation # 127EAU26Q0077
The U.S. Department of Agriculture Agricultural Research Service is soliciting quotes for a one-time cleanout and disposal of hazardous, non-hazardous, and universal waste at the USDA/ARS facility in Tifton, Georgia. This 100% Small Business Set-Aside under NAICS Code 562112 requires the contractor to provide all labor, safety equipment, and DOT-approved shipping containers to perform lab packing, profiling, manifesting, stabilization, removal, and transportation of waste to approved disposal sites. The contractor must ensure full compliance with RCRA, DOT, and Title 40 of the Code of Federal Regulations, and is responsible for providing qualified staff trained in Hazardous Waste Operations and Emergency Response. The anticipated period of performance is from October 1, 2026, through December 30, 2026, with all disposal activities required to be completed by the end date. Key deliverables include the submission of Uniform Hazardous Waste Manifests for review by the Hazardous Waste Coordinator and the delivery of Certificates of Disposal within three months of receipt, which must also be submitted to the EPA eManifest system. Offers are due by September 18, 2026, at 12:00 PM Pacific Time and must be submitted electronically to veronica.beck@usda.gov using the provided Schedule of Items spreadsheet for lump sum pricing. Offerors must be registered in the System for Award Management to be eligible for award.
